S395 LJB is a 1998 Skoda Felicia in Blue with a 1,289c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.
Across all 1998 Skoda Felicia models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.9% with a typical mileage of 67,201 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Skoda Felicia f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 58,886 recorded failures. If you're considering buying S395 LJB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Skoda Felicia typ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 28 years old, this Skoda Felicia is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
